Quote:
Originally Posted by HobokenJon View Post
Ted, my view is (1) the 150 backs for these three variation cards exist on the original versions of the cards showing their former teams, and (2) some 150-350 subjects -- i.e., these three -- aren't found with 150 backs, just as the cards from the 150-only series aren't found with 350 backs.

It also is worth nothing that G. Brown (Chicago) is part of the 150-only series, unlike Dahlen (Boston) and Elberfeld portrait (N.Y.).

But as I think we've established, a lot of this is just theory. The cards weren't issued with a checklist or a printing schedule. The mystery and the mystique are part of what makes the Monster so much fun to collect, talk about, and even vigorously debate!

Per Dahlen Brooklyn, it looks like you and Pat might have a disagreement on facts. I previously wasn't aware of either (1) what Pat said above in post #24, or (2) what you said above in post #31 regarding the notation being found on cards across the five series. I'm not in a position yet to draw a conclusion on this question.

Jon

Back in 2011, a Net54 member posted Rhoades (right arm extended) SWEET CAP card with the hint of large Factory # on its edge. This card is strictly a 350-only subject.

And, there are more out there. I've been collecting T206's since 1981, and trust me, I have had and have seen over 50,000 of them.

I will see if I can come up with more like the above mentioned one in the 350-only series (or 350/460 series, or the 460-only series).


TED Z
